Дано: 0. Речь идёт о frontend части компонента. 1. Имеется собственный компонент который привязан к пункту меню(Itemid=61). 2. К этому пункту меню привязан дополнительный шаблон сайта для вывода моего компонента. 3. В компоненте организую ссылку, использующую плагин JQuery(prettyPopin), для вызова модального окна, и подгрузки в него формы используя AJAX. 4. Открытие модального окна и подгрузка формы происходит из моего компонента при нажатии на ссылку(только компонент без мишуры tmpl=component): Код (html): JRoute::_( 'index.php?option=com_printfabric&task=add&tmpl=component'); 5. Код из плагина prettyPopin привязанный к ссылке и отправляющий AJAX запрос: Код (html): $.get($(this).attr('href'),function(responseText){ $('.prettyPopin .prettyContent .prettyContent-container').html(responseText); //и т.д Проблема: Как уже написал выше, компонент использует отдельный шаблон который подгружает свой css. Всё как и должно быть... Но вызов AJAX запроса из модального окна возвращает в браузер подцепленный css моего СТАНДАРТНОГО ШАБЛОНА! используемого для всего остального сайта, соответственно меняя стили на фоне модального окна(по краям модального окна видно страницу компонента в лёгком затемнении), соответственно разрушая компоновку страницы. ВОПРОСЫ: 1. откуда и на каком этапе цепляется вредоносный css в обход Itemid? 2. какие выходы из этой ситуации можете подсказать? Заранее благодарен за ответы.